Publisher's summary

From USA Today best-selling author Laura Scott

Separated by tragedy, reunited by love

A safe place to call home...

After escaping her abusive foster parents 13 years ago, Hailey Donovan thought her nightmare was over. Gatlinburg, Tennessee, had been a safe place to live—until she's nearly hit by gunfire while hiking the Smoky Mountains. Her instincts are to avoid law enforcement, especially handsome park ranger Rock Wilson, but when more gunfire echoes around them, they're forced to work together to escape. More attempts against Hailey convinces her to leave the city to start over someplace new.

Rock talks her into staying and fighting against the unknown assailant. Rock senses Hailey has been traumatized in the past, and is determined to uncover the mystery surrounding her. As Hailey and Rock seek the truth behind the escalating attacks, Rock realizes he's also in danger of losing his heart. Can Rock provide Hailey the safe haven she desperately needs? Or will evil triumph over love?
